Experts believe US elections cannot be hacked because they’re mostly offline

Russian hacking U.S in the upcoming presidential election became a hot topic during the debate on Sunday night. It raised a question: can the U.S elections really be hacked?

Experts had a say on a national level. They believe it cannot happen. But there is still enough evidence that leaves us with this question.

According to most cybersecurity professionals, the U.S systems are under no threat from hackers. This is because the systems are too decentralized and most of them operate offline.

In order to be effectively hacked, the systems need to be online. But since they aren’t, there is little to no threat.
